FDA demands poll process be stopped

KATHMANDU, June 13: The Federal Democratic Alliance (FDA) warned on Thursday that the country would face serious consequences if the major parties embark on the electoral process without taking the FDA into confidence on disputed issues related to the Constituent Assembly elections.



FDA-aligned leaders urged the major parties not to announce the date of fresh CA elections without consent of  the agitating parties under FDA. Addressing at a press conference this afternoon, Mohan Baidhya, the chairman of CPN-Maoist, a principal force in the alliance, demanded that the ongoing procedure for CA elections be immediately stopped. He warned that elections would be impossible if the government act unilaterally. Meanwhile, Chairman of Federal Socialist Party (FSP) Ashol Rai stressed that the ‘four-party syndicate’ should end. Along with the CPN Maoist, the FSP and the Upendra Yada-led Madhesi Janaadhikar Forum, among other disgruntled parties, make up the 41-party alliance that has been pressing for replacement of the incumbent Khil Raj Regmi-led government with a new government under political leadership.
